Wikoff Color Corporation announced the appointment of Jeff Czarnecki as its new VP of strategic marketing and business development. Based at Wikoff Color’s corporate headquarters in Fort Mill, SC, Czarnecki will be responsible for overseeing strategic initiatives to drive market growth and development.
Czarnecki started his career working as a project engineer for Gilbert Associates in Reading, PA. Czarnecki spent more than 27 years at Honeywell, where he was VP/GM of four different specialty chemical business units and commercial excellence leader for a $4 billion strategic business unit.
Czarnecki went on to become VP of sales and marketing for Vertellus Inc., a specialty chemical manufacturer. His career continued at Kollmorgen, Inc., an industrial automation company, where he was the VP of global marketing and regional VP/GM of the Americas. In his most recent role, Czarnecki was president for Warner Electric, an electro-magnetic clutch and brake manufacturer.
Czarnecki officially assumed his role on April 22, 2024.
